package org.zanata.adapter.po;
import java.io.File;
import java.io.FileWriter;
import java.io.IOException;
import java.io.OutputStream;
import java.io.OutputStreamWriter;
import java.io.Writer;
import java.util.HashMap;
import java.util.List;
import java.util.Map;
import org.apache.commons.lang.StringUtils;
import org.fedorahosted.tennera.jgettext.HeaderFields;
import org.fedorahosted.tennera.jgettext.Message;
import org.slf4j.Logger;
import org.slf4j.LoggerFactory;
import org.zanata.common.ContentState;
import org.zanata.rest.dto.extensions.comment.SimpleComment;
import org.zanata.rest.dto.extensions.gettext.HeaderEntry;
import org.zanata.rest.dto.extensions.gettext.PoHeader;
import org.zanata.rest.dto.extensions.gettext.PoTargetHeader;
import org.zanata.rest.dto.extensions.gettext.PotEntryHeader;
import org.zanata.rest.dto.resource.Resource;
import org.zanata.rest.dto.resource.TextFlow;
import org.zanata.rest.dto.resource.TextFlowTarget;
import org.zanata.rest.dto.resource.TranslationsResource;
import org.zanata.util.PathUtil;
public class PoWriter2
{
private static final Logger log = LoggerFactory.getLogger(PoWriter2.class);
private final org.fedorahosted.tennera.jgettext.PoWriter poWriter = new org.fedorahosted.tennera.jgettext.PoWriter();
public PoWriter2()
{
}
private void mkdirs(File dir) throws IOException
{
if (!dir.exists())
{
if (!dir.mkdirs())
throw new IOException("unable to create output directory: " + dir);
}
}
/**
* Generates a pot file from Resource (document), using the publican
* directory layout.
*
* @param baseDir
* @param doc
* @throws IOException
*/
public void writePot(File baseDir, Resource doc) throws IOException
{
// write the POT file to pot/$name.pot
File potDir = new File(baseDir, "pot");
writePotToDir(potDir, doc);
}
/**
* Generates a pot file from Resource (document), in the specified directory.
*
* @param potDir
* @param doc
* @throws IOException
*/
public void writePotToDir(File potDir, Resource doc) throws IOException
{
// write the POT file to $potDir/$name.pot
File potFile = new File(potDir, doc.getName() + ".pot");
PathUtil.makeParents(potFile);
FileWriter fWriter = new FileWriter(potFile);
write(fWriter, "UTF-8", doc, null);
}
/**
* Generates a po file from a Resource and a TranslationsResource, using the
* publican directory layout.
*
* @param baseDir
* @param doc
* @param locale
* @param targetDoc
* @throws IOException
*/
public void writePo(File baseDir, Resource doc, String locale, TranslationsResource targetDoc) throws IOException
{
// write the PO file to $locale/$name.po
File localeDir = new File(baseDir, locale);
File poFile = new File(localeDir, doc.getName() + ".po");
mkdirs(poFile.getParentFile());
FileWriter fWriter = new FileWriter(poFile);
write(fWriter, "UTF-8", doc, targetDoc);
}
/**
* Generates a po file from a Resource and a TranslationsResource, writing it
* directly to an output stream.
*
* @param stream
* @param doc
* @param targetDoc
* @throws IOException
*/
public void writePo(OutputStream stream, String charset, Resource doc, TranslationsResource targetDoc) throws IOException
{
OutputStreamWriter osWriter = new OutputStreamWriter(stream, charset);
write(osWriter, charset, doc, targetDoc);
}
/**
* Generates a pot or po file from a Resource and/or TranslationsResource,
* using the publican directory layout. If targetDoc is non-null, a po file
* will be generated from Resource+TranslationsResource, otherwise a pot file
* will be generated from the Resource only.
*
* @param writer
* @param document
* @param targetDoc
* @throws IOException
*/
private void write(Writer writer, String charset, Resource document, TranslationsResource targetDoc) throws IOException
{
PoHeader poHeader = document.getExtensions(true).findByType(PoHeader.class);
HeaderFields hf = new HeaderFields();
if (poHeader == null)
{
log.warn("No PO header in document named " + document.getName());
}
else
{
copyToHeaderFields(hf, poHeader.getEntries());
}
setEncodingHeaderFields(hf, charset);
Message headerMessage = null;
if (targetDoc != null)
{
PoTargetHeader poTargetHeader = targetDoc.getExtensions(true).findByType(PoTargetHeader.class);
if (poTargetHeader != null)
{
copyToHeaderFields(hf, poTargetHeader.getEntries());
headerMessage = hf.unwrap();
headerMessage.setFuzzy(false); // By default, header message unwraps as fuzzy, so avoid it
copyTargetHeaderComments(headerMessage, poTargetHeader);
}
}
if (headerMessage == null)
{
headerMessage = hf.unwrap();
}
poWriter.write(headerMessage, writer);
writer.write("\n");
Map<String, TextFlowTarget> targets = null;
if (targetDoc != null)
{
targets = new HashMap<String, TextFlowTarget>();
for (TextFlowTarget target : targetDoc.getTextFlowTargets())
{
targets.put(target.getResId(), target);
}
}
// first write header
for (TextFlow textFlow : document.getTextFlows())
{
PotEntryHeader entryData = textFlow.getExtensions(true).findByType(PotEntryHeader.class);
SimpleComment srcComment = textFlow.getExtensions().findByType(SimpleComment.class);
Message message = new Message();
message.setMsgid(textFlow.getContent());
message.setMsgstr("");
if (targetDoc != null)
{
TextFlowTarget contentData = targets.get(textFlow.getId());
if (contentData != null)
{
if (entryData == null)
{
log.warn("Missing POT entry for text-flow ID " + textFlow.getId());
}
else if (!contentData.getResId().equals(textFlow.getId()))
{
throw new RuntimeException("ID from target doesn't match text-flow ID");
}
message.setMsgstr(contentData.getContent());
SimpleComment poComment = contentData.getExtensions().findByType(SimpleComment.class);
if (poComment != null)
{
String[] comments = poComment.getValue().split("\n");
if (comments.length == 1 && comments[0].isEmpty())
{
// nothing
}
else
{
for (String comment : comments)
{
message.getComments().add(comment);
}
}
}
if (contentData.getState() == ContentState.NeedReview)
{
message.setFuzzy(true);
}
}
}
if (entryData != null)
copyToMessage(entryData, srcComment, message);
poWriter.write(message, writer);
writer.write("\n");
}
}
private static void copyTargetHeaderComments(Message headerMessage, PoTargetHeader poTargetHeader)
{
for (String s : poTargetHeader.getComment().split("\n"))
{
headerMessage.addComment(s);
}
}
static void setEncodingHeaderFields(HeaderFields hf, String charset)
{
hf.setValue(HeaderFields.KEY_MimeVersion, "1.0");
hf.setValue(HeaderFields.KEY_ContentTransferEncoding, "8bit");
String ct, contentType = hf.getValue(HeaderFields.KEY_ContentType);
if (contentType == null)
{
ct = "text/plain; charset=" + charset;
}
else
{
ct = contentType.replaceFirst("charset=[^;]*", "charset=" + charset);
}
hf.setValue(HeaderFields.KEY_ContentType, ct);
}
static void copyToHeaderFields(HeaderFields hf, final List<HeaderEntry> entries)
{
for (HeaderEntry e : entries)
{
hf.setValue(e.getKey(), e.getValue());
}
}
private static void copyToMessage(PotEntryHeader data, SimpleComment simpleComment, Message message)
{
if (data != null)
{
String context = data.getContext();
if (context != null)
message.setMsgctxt(context);
for (String flag : data.getFlags())
{
message.addFormat(flag);
}
for (String ref : data.getReferences())
{
message.addSourceReference(ref);
}
}
if (simpleComment != null)
{
String[] comments = StringUtils.splitPreserveAllTokens(simpleComment.getValue(), "\n");
if (!(comments.length == 1 && comments[0].isEmpty()))
{
for (String comment : comments)
{
message.addExtractedComment(comment);
}
}
}
}
}
